What is a Compound Feed Sewing Machine?


A compound feed sewing machine is a type of industrial sewing machine that uses a unique feeding mechanism to move the fabric during sewing. The term compound feed refers to the combination of multiple feeding systems at work. These machines typically combine needle feed, walking foot, and feed dogs, allowing for precise control over the material during the sewing process.


In essence, the needle feed mechanism moves the needle up and down while simultaneously pulling the fabric through. The walking foot, which grips the top layer of material, moves in conjunction with the feed dogs that control the bottom layer. This synchronized movement ensures that multiple layers of fabric are fed evenly, reducing the chances of slipping or shifting. This is particularly important when working with heavy or thick materials like canvas, leather, or multiple layers of fabric, where traditional machines might struggle.


Key Features and Benefits


One of the primary advantages of a compound feed sewing machine is its ability to handle a wide range of fabric types. From thin nylon to thick denim, these machines offer versatility that is hard to match. This capability is especially valuable in industries such as fashion, upholstery, and automotive manufacturing, where materials can vary significantly from one project to another.

Additionally, the design of compound feed machines significantly reduces the risk of uneven stitching, which is a common challenge when sewing thicker materials. The walking foot mechanism ensures that the top and bottom layers of fabric move in unison, allowing for consistent stitch formation and reducing the likelihood of puckering or distortion.


Furthermore, compound feed sewing machines are designed for durability and heavy-duty performance. They are built to withstand continuous operation, making them perfect for high-volume production environments. Many models are equipped with robust motors and reinforced frames to tackle the most challenging sewing tasks without compromising on efficiency or quality.


Applications


The applications of compound feed sewing machines are vast. In the apparel industry, they are used for stitching jackets, bags, and other garments that require precision when working with thick materials. Upholstery professionals utilize these machines for sewing furniture covers and automotive seats, where multi-layered materials are the norm. Additionally, industries such as footwear manufacturing also benefit from the capabilities of compound feed sewing machines, as they can sew through multiple layers of leather and other synthetic materials effectively.
